Transaction 644e94321c53090ba46aa6559a07c96e28bf9dbc946668f9bc01a33cd4c02fd4

3 Input
2 Outputs
  • 644e94321c53090ba46aa6559a07c96e28bf9dbc946668f9bc01a33cd4c02fd4:0
  • value  4517476
    address  3MFrtd4eLGJh9ACMSFbt1khokr8masK7ES
  • 644e94321c53090ba46aa6559a07c96e28bf9dbc946668f9bc01a33cd4c02fd4:1
  • value  825776
    address  3JqvfJnVUUHDgAuReDChbjQNUd9DH6xVnZ